Analysis

MegaFood pairs a meaningful amount of stinging nettle with biotin and zinc to support your body's structural proteins. The inclusion of nettle may contribute minerals that are helpful for overall tissue maintenance.

This is a practical multi-nutrient supplement for anyone focusing on their external health from the inside out. It uses high-quality forms of vitamins, like Vitamin B6 in the active P-5-P form, for better utility.

Ingredients

IngredientAmount per serving
Vitamin A (Beta-Carotene)
600 mcg RAE
Vitamin C (Ascorbic Acid)
200 mg
Vitamin E (D-Alpha-Tocopherol)
20 mg
Vitamin B6 (Pyridoxal-5-Phosphate)
4 mg
Biotin
300 mcg
Pantothenic Acid (Calcium D-Pantothenate)
20 mg
Zinc (Zinc Bisglycinate)
15 mg
Selenium (fermented Selenium Glycinate)
50 mcg
Nettle (Urtica dioica)
500 mg
